Kynar® SUPERFLEX 2500-20

 

Kynar® FLEX2500-20 is a thermoplastic fluorinated polymer

 

The properties are the same as standard grades :

chemical resistance, resistance to UV, low permeation, high purity, excellent mechanical behaviour.

 

More over, this grade is very flexible and is suitable in electrical isolation cable.

 

This grade is available as pellet form for injection, extrusion, compression.

Rheological propertiesValueUnitTest Standard
Melt volume-flow rate, MVR 8 cm³/10min ISO 1133
Temperature 230 °C ISO 1133
Load 3.8 kg ISO 1133
Mechanical propertiesValueUnitTest Standard
Yield stress 12 MPa ISO 527-1/-2
Yield strain 18 % ISO 527-1/-2
Nominal strain at break >50 % ISO 527-1/-2
Thermal propertiesValueUnitTest Standard
Melting temperature, 10°C/min 117 °C ISO 11357-1/-3
Temp. of deflection under load, 1.80 MPa 31 °C ISO 75-1/-2
Oxygen index 44 % ISO 4589-1/-2
Electrical propertiesValueUnitTest Standard
Electric strength 12 kV/mm IEC 60243-1
Other propertiesValueUnitTest Standard
Density 1790 kg/m³ ISO 1183
Characteristics
Processing
Injection Molding, Sheet Extrusion, Coating, Transfer Molding
Delivery form
Pellets
Special Characteristics
Light stabilized or stable to light, U.V. stabilized or stable to weather, Heat stabilized or stable to heat
